How virtual interviews enable monitoring. Software can track active windows, audio levels, and even eye movement with consent. Company devices or required apps often enable deeper visibility into participant behavior. Research shows monitoring adoption rose with widespread remote work.
Practical takeaway for candidates. Clarify tools and policies before the call to understand your boundaries.
Can employers legally record without telling you?
Monitoring usually requires disclosure and consent per company policy and local law.
What should you do if uncomfortable during screen share?
Politely ask about recording scope, or mute/disable non essential apps if possible.
